When you apply a CBD salve to your skin, the cannabidiol interacts with cannabinoid receptors located in the skin, muscles, and surrounding tissue at the point of application. Your body has what’s called an endocannabinoid system — a real biological network involved in regulating pain, inflammation, and other functions. Topical CBD engages that system locally, which is why a salve can help with a specific sore knee or tight shoulder without affecting the rest of your body. It doesn’t enter your bloodstream in meaningful amounts, which is what makes it a targeted option rather than a systemic one. Most users start to feel something within 10 to 30 minutes of applying it.
This is one of the most common questions we get, especially from Long Island’s large professional and government-employed workforce. The short answer is that topical CBD does not enter your bloodstream in any meaningful amount, which means the likelihood of it triggering a positive drug test is extremely low. Our salve is hemp-derived with 0.3% THC or less, in full compliance with federal law under the 2018 Farm Bill and with New York State regulations. The main difference comes down to the base. A salve is oil- and wax-based, which makes it thicker and more concentrated. That consistency allows it to stay on the skin longer and deliver a more potent dose of CBD to a specific area. A lotion or cream is water-based, which spreads more easily over a larger surface but absorbs more quickly and may not be as effective for deep, localized discomfort. If you’re dealing with a specific problem area — a bad knee, a stiff shoulder, chronic lower back tension — a salve is generally the better tool for that job. It’s why we chose a salve formulation for muscle and joint pain specifically.
